: Users can convert partitions between different file systems (e.g., NTFS to FAT32) and convert dynamic disks back to basic disks without data loss. This feature supports flexibility in disk configuration and compatibility with various operating systems.
: One of the standout features is the ability to migrate the operating system to an SSD (Solid State Drive) or another disk without reinstalling Windows. This process is streamlined and straightforward, making it accessible even to users who are not tech-savvy.

Consolidate data from two adjacent or non-contiguous volumes into one unified directory structure. The program relocates the contents of the secondary storage volume into a safe subfolder on the target drive automatically.
